Where to Stay for Your San Diego Bachelorette Party
One of the best things about planning a San Diego bachelorette party is choosing the perfect neighborhood. Each area offers a completely different vibe depending on what your group is looking for.
La Jolla
If your bride loves coastal luxury, boutique shopping, and breathtaking ocean views, La Jolla is hard to beat. Spend your days exploring the village, relaxing by the water, and dining at some of San Diego's best restaurants.
Pacific Beach
Looking for a lively beach town atmosphere? Pacific Beach is perfect for groups who want easy beach access, casual brunch spots, fun bars, and a vibrant nightlife scene.
Mission Beach
Mission Beach offers the classic Southern California vacation experience with beachfront vacation rentals, the iconic boardwalk, and plenty of room for larger groups.
Gaslamp Quarter
For brides who want to be in the heart of the action, the Gaslamp Quarter puts you within walking distance of rooftop bars, restaurants, nightlife, and entertainment.
Little Italy
Foodies will love Little Italy's walkable streets lined with charming cafés, incredible restaurants, wine bars, and local boutiques.

How many days should you spend in San Diego for a bachelorette party?
We recommend planning a three- or four-day weekend This gives your group enough time to enjoy the beach, explore several neighborhoods, experience San Diego's nightlife, and relax without feeling rushed.
Where is the best place to stay for a San Diego bachelorette party?
It depends on your group's style.
- La Jolla - is perfect for luxury, coastal views, and boutique shopping.
- Pacific Beach - offers beach bars, brunch spots, and nightlife.
- Mission Beach - is ideal for large vacation rentals and easy beach access.
- Gaslamp Quarter - puts you close to restaurants, rooftop bars, and nightlife.
- Little Italy - is a favorite for foodies who love walkable neighborhoods.
What is the best time of year to visit San Diego?
San Diego is a fantastic destination year-round, but spring through fall typically offers the warmest weather for beach days, boat charters, rooftop dining, and outdoor activities.
